Microsoft Launches Free Bing Video Creator for AI Videos

Bing

Microsoft has introduced a new addition to its suite of AI-powered tools, Bing Video Creator. The tool enables users to transform written descriptions into concise, high-quality videos utilizing advanced generative AI technology. Initially available on the Bing Mobile App, Bing Video Creator will soon be integrated into desktop platforms and Copilot Search.

This launch marks the next phase in Microsoft's mission to redefine digital creativity. Following the success of Bing Image Creator and the recent rollout of Copilot Search, Bing Video Creator aims to make AI video generation effortless and accessible to all users worldwide, excluding those in China and Russia.

Bringing Ideas to Life Through AI

Bing Video Creator lets users create 5-second videos by simply entering descriptive text prompts. The AI, powered by OpenAI’s Sora, interprets the prompt and generates a corresponding video clip in vertical (9:16) format. A horizontal (16:9) format is expected to roll out soon.

Users can generate up to three videos at a time, and each video can be downloaded, shared across social media, or saved for up to 90 days. Creations can be made at Standard speed or at Fast speed using free credits. Users receive 10 Fast creations initially, with additional Fast credits available in exchange for 100 Microsoft Rewards points each.

How to Use Bing Video Creator?

Bing video

To get started,

  • Open the Bing Mobile App.
  • Tap the menu at the bottom-right corner and select Video Creator.
  • Alternatively, type a prompt, such as “Create a video of…” directly into the Bing search bar.

After submitting a prompt, such as “a baby panda riding a bicycle in a park during autumn,” the video is generated within seconds. The platform encourages users to include vivid descriptions, camera angles, lighting, and tone for best results.

Videos can be shared via social media, email, or by copying a direct link. The platform also supports queuing of multiple creations, offering seamless user interaction.

Tips for Better Results

To maximize the quality of the generated videos.

  • Use specific and detailed prompts. Add context, characters, actions, and environments.
  • Include action words and scene descriptors like “dancing,” “cinematic,” or “sunset lighting.”
  • Specify tone and style, such as “animated like a cartoon” or “shot in the style of a dramatic movie trailer.”

Built with Responsibility in Mind

Microsoft has integrated multiple layers of safeguards to ensure the responsible use of Bing Video Creator. The system incorporates OpenAI's existing safety features and Microsoft’s Responsible AI Standard. Prompts that may generate harmful or inappropriate content are automatically blocked. Additionally, every video includes C2PA-compliant content credentials to verify AI generation and maintain transparency.
